Early Career at Real Madrid

Casillas joined Real Madrid’s youth academy, La Fábrica, at a young age. He quickly rose through the ranks and made his first-team debut in 1999. Over the years, he became a symbol of the club, known for his exceptional reflexes and leadership on the pitch.
